Kdenlive 的故事
歷史
Kdenlive is a community project which aims to deliver a free and open source video editing software application to allow everybody to produce high quality content in order to increase the democratization of the media. The application has a graphical user interface written in C++ with Qt and uses KDE libraries for the MLT framework written by Dan Dennedy, which relies on FFmpeg to decode and encode almost all the video and audio formats that are available today, and which hosts effects libraries like Frei0r and Movit for video, and LADSPA and SOX for audio.
According to the official documents that we can find on the internet, the project was launched by Jason Wood, who released version 0.2.3 in October 2003. Soon, Kdenlive 0.2.4 followed, but the community did not yet exist and the group was very small.
The project stopped for two years. Before the end of 2005, Jean-Baptiste Mardelle, who heard that the project would be re-activated, offered his help. And in 2006, he signed the post of the new release 0.3 of the program. From this moment on, he became the main reference point for the project.
Version 0.4 and 0.5 are soon distributed, but there is an issue. A refactoring of the code is needed to go forward. The program has to be moved from KDE 3, which is not compatible with MLT, to KDE 4. The rewriting ends in 2008, followed by several new releases, but in 2011, a further migration from KDE 4 to KDE 5 was needed to allow the program to grow.
In 2012, a crowdfunding campaign is launched to fund the operation, and before the end of 2014, the goal is reached. Then finally, in 2015, Kdenlive becomes an official KDE application. Jean-Baptiste was invited to Akademy, KDE's annual world summit, to present ten years of activity.
The new perspective is to make the project even bigger. Before the end of the year, the first Kdenlive Café is announced with the aim of getting more people involved. During this virtual meeting, it immediately became clear that in order to grow, Kdenlive needed to be cross-platform. The Windows version was announced in 2016, began with a sprint meeting followed by the new logo and the new site.
But as soon as the development of new features started, it was evident that the code for the timeline had to be rewritten, because it was too old and no longer fit for purpose. Everybody knew that the refactoring could take several months or years, but the community did not lose enthusiasm.
In 2018, a roadmap was written, and in 2019, the refactored code was distributed, although some fine tuning was still needed. Then finally, since 2020, continuing up to now, the long-awaited new features along with a wide variety of new effects and dozens of important improvements have been continuously added to create the most powerful, free, and open source video editing application ever.

技術
Through the MLT framework, Kdenlive integrates many plugin effects for video and sound processing or creation. Furthermore, Kdenlive brings a powerful title editor, a subtitling solution, and can then be used as a complete studio for video creation.
Video effects are provided by Frei0r while audio effects use LADSPA.
授權條款
這個程式是自由軟體基金會所描述的自由軟體,使用 GNU General Public License 授權條款。
不用付授權費、不用註冊或訂閱,也沒有需要付費才能解鎖的進階版功能。
Kdenlive 是 KDE 社群的一部分。KDE e.V. 是代表 KDE 社群的法人,是一個德國的非營利組織。
